- [ ] Step 7: Archive cold storage buckets (Glacierline tier). Confirm both ceremony witnesses are present, verify bucket manifests match the Oxbow ledger, then seal the archive key shares. Plugin authors may observe but not handle shares. Once sealed, the archive index itself is encrypted and can only be reopened with the passphrase below.

vault phrase of badup-hahig = tamael-aldael-kelmir-istael-fenok-istwyn-tamius-jorath-oliion

Subject: Quickstore 4.2 — bloom filter now fronts the KV layer

Plugin authors: starting with this release, Quickstore places a bloom filter ahead of the key-value store. Negative lookups return faster; false positives fall through safely. No API changes are required on your side. Verify your plugin against the staging build referenced below.

session token of fahif-tadup = htk3_9c7

**Ticket #4471 — GalleryWhisper vault locked again**

Hey — the release vault for GalleryWhisper (the audio-guide app for the Marlowe Pavilion exhibits) locked itself after three failed unseal attempts during last night's build. Signing keys for the 3.2 tour-pack release are inside, so we can't ship until it's open. Per the runbook, the release manager can unseal it manually from the build box. Fire up the vault CLI, choose manual unseal, and when it asks, supply the recovery passphrase shown directly below this line.

strongbox words: norwyn-wenael-aldvan-aldiel-wendor-holael

Ticket #4417 — Vault locked during lint rule rollout

The Quillbase credentials vault locked itself after three failed unlock attempts by the CI runner applying our new SQL linting rules. The linter (SqueakyLint) now rejects unquoted identifiers and trailing semicolons in migration files, and the vault agent's config was caught by the same pipeline. Support should unlock the vault so the lint job can fetch its read-only token. The recovery passphrase for the Quillbase vault follows below.

unlock words, hahip-baduf: holwyn-istath-julvan

Facilities Ticket — Cleaning Crew Access, Brindle Annex

For new starters handling evening lock-up: the Sorano Cleaning crew arrives nightly at 21:30 via the annex side door. Check their rota sheet, note arrival in the log, and ensure the storeroom is relocked afterward. To let them through the side door, enter the access code below.

badge for yaweg-hafog: bdg-GX-6